Association of GLOD4 with Alzheimers Disease in Humans and Mice
Glyoxylase domain containing protein (GLOD4) is associated with Alzheimers disease (AD). We quantified GLOD4 in human AD brains, mouse AD model, and neuroblastoma N2a-APPswe cells. We found that GLOD4 was downregulated in human AD patients compared to non-AD controls. Glod4 was similarly downregulated in Blmh-/-5xFAD mouse model of AD. Downregulated Glod4 was associated with elevated A{beta} and worsened memory/sensorimotor performance in Blmh-/-5xFAD mice. Glod4 depletion in N2a-APPswe cells upregulated A{beta}PP and downregulated autophagy-related Atg5 and p62 genes. These findings suggest that Glod4 interacts with A{beta}PP and the autophagy pathway, disruption of these interactions leads to A{beta} accumulation and cognitive/neurosensory deficits.
